I don't know of any swaps, but I hear you can stroke an F20 or F22 to a 2.4/2.5L using a K24 crank.
Infact, I hear alot of K2x parts can fit in the F20/F22, although I don't see a reason for it other than the crank (cheap stroker kit).

Tne B series spin counterclockwise as do the older honda engines. Starting with the K series, they got with the rest of the world and started spinning clockwise. What direction does the F20 turn, clockwise or counterclockwise? I think it's clockwise.
